Alexander SINCLAIR

Birthabout 1839 - Saint Ninians, Stirlingshire, Scotland
Death23 Apr 1892 - St Ninians, Stirlingshire, Scotland
MotherNot Available
FatherNot Available

Born in Saint Ninians, Stirlingshire, Scotland on about 1839. Alexander SINCLAIR married Elizabeth CARMICHAEL and had 11 children. He passed away on 23 Apr 1892 in St Ninians, Stirlingshire, Scotland.
